Creating Better Security For Video Chat Accounts
One of the most effective ways to improve online safety is by using strong and unique passwords. Avoid using the same password across multiple websites or applications. A secure password should include a combination of uppercase letters, l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ols.
Two-factor authentication adds another layer of account protection for users. These systems help reduce the chances of unauthorized logins.
Protecting Your Identity In Live Conversations
Users should remain cautious about revealing private details during online conversations:
• Personal location details
• Personal telephone information
• Sensitive payment information
• Personal identification numbers
• Workplace information
• Personal social media accounts
Small details shared during conversations may unintentionally expose sensitive information. Checking the camera environment before starting a video chat can improve personal privacy.
Features That Help Protect User Data
Modern video chat platforms often use encryption and account verification systems to improve security. Features such as HTTPS protection, encrypted messaging, identity verification, and secure payment systems help reduce certain online risks.
It is recommended that users examine a platform’s security standards before registering. Trusted services often explain how user information is protected.
Recognizing Common Online Risks
Internet scams and fake accounts remain common concerns across digital communities. Downloading unverified files may increase cybersecurity risks.
Common suspicious behaviors may involve:
• Requests for money or financial assistance
• Moving communication away from trusted platforms
• Fake verification messages
• Requests involving confidential material
Remaining cautious can significantly reduce exposure to online threats.
Protecting Your Data On Public Networks
Open Wi-Fi networks can sometimes create privacy concerns for online users. Whenever possible, users should connect through trusted private networks or use a VPN service for additional privacy.
System updates may help reduce potential online security weaknesses.
